AFD Activities in Palestine
Since the beginning of its activities in 1999, just ten years ago, AFD will have committed 29 different projects for a total amount of 152 million Euros focusing mainly on infrastructures, including the agreements to be signed on June 4th. The total disbursement rate is 55.7 % which underlines a slower pace in implementation on the last years due to the Gaza situation.
